It starts in production. Manufactured in Japan under very strict Quality Control guidelines. IOMIC grips are made to an extremely tight tolerance level. On other rubber grips, the tolerance level is wider, causing weight differentials and irregularities in ergonomics. This difference in weight and ergonomics is largely because of the highly specialised manufacturing process.
IOMIC’s tight tolerance level & manufacturing process results in a grip that weighs what is says it should whilst at the same time making it an extremely ergonomic grip.
IOMIC Golf Grips are made, for the main, from a material called Elastomer. This is the same material used to line windows in cars, making IOMIC Grips 100% impermeable.

Using Elastomer also means that IOMIC golf grips are 2/3 times more effective at repelling Ultra Violet rays - giving the grips a longer life span compared with ordinary, rubber grips.
Elastomer is also less spongy compared to rubber (when you look at rubber under a microscope it has pockets of air, similar to a sponge, that retain water and air giving poor friction). Elastomer has a much more ‘compact’ molecular structure allowing superior adhesiveness whilst at the same time dramatically reducing torque.

How are they made?
IOMIC grips are made by a process called ‘injection manufacturing’. As the name would suggest, the Elastomer mix is injected into a mould, allowed time to set, then out pops a grip that is smooth and blemish free. This new process alone ensures IOMIC grips are produced to a much greater quality in terms of ergonomics and weight tolerance.
NB: Rubber grips are ‘wrap moulded’ and then scraped giving the finished product an uneven surface inside the grip.

Why does the butt of the grip feel harder than the rest of it?
In ordinary rubber grips, the hardness of the rubber is measured and remains the same throughout the grip. IOMIC feel that most twisting and torque occurs at the butt of the grip during a shot. To counteract this, IOMIC grips are made harder at the butt resulting in a more stable grip at the moment of impact.
